Core Points - Russian President Putin stated that military operations have resumed after the temporary ceasefire during Easter, emphasizing Russia's positive attitude towards ceasefire proposals and willingness to evaluate Ukraine's suggestions for an extended ceasefire [1] - Ukrainian President Zelensky announced a meeting in London with representatives from Ukraine, the UK, France, and the US to discuss ceasefire and peace initiatives, highlighting the importance of unconditional ceasefire as a step towards lasting peace [3] - The Russian Defense Ministry reported ongoing military operations, targeting Ukrainian military infrastructure, including airfields and ammunition depots, while claiming to have shot down over 100 Ukrainian drones [4][5] Group 1 - Putin expressed Russia's openness to peace initiatives and bilateral dialogue regarding the proposal to avoid striking civilian infrastructure [1] - Zelensky described a constructive conversation with UK Prime Minister Starmer and emphasized Ukraine's commitment to achieving an unconditional ceasefire [3] - The Russian military continued operations, striking multiple targets in Ukraine, including military vehicles and drone warehouses [4] Group 2 - Ukrainian military reported ongoing fierce battles in the Sumy region, successfully repelling Russian advances [5] - Ukrainian air defense claimed to have intercepted 42 drones on the same day, indicating active defense against Russian attacks [5] - The Russian military's actions included launching various missile types and conducting drone strikes, affecting several Ukrainian regions [5]
